 37's post your hours
If you've got a fuel injected Briggs, post up how many total hours you have put on it, your impressions so far and if you're stock or modified. Please include when the mods were done, etc. Also, if you have had issues or repairs, state what issue you had and roughly when it occurred
Just trying to get a rough consensus of how they are doing as a whole.
I'll start.
Mines a 2015 model built 10/14, ran completely stock since day one. Maintained very well.
At ~30hrs I had the wiring harness issue fixed At ~80hrs it got complete cylinder heads

 Re: 37's post your hours
2015 Gtr Ran stock until 45 hours. Iam running a 19 60 boat.. Would not push a 3 man load up river with the currents I run..
Installed Barracuda kit from glade at 45 hours..
Currently have roughly 180 hours on it.. Hour meter broke and it was a few days till I got a new one..
No issues with motor, pushes 3 man load 23mph up river which suits me just fine..
